Nobody's Business
Originally released in 1996. Nobody's Business is a documentary film. directed by Alan Berliner. At just 60 minutes, it's a tight, focused story.
Starring Alan Berliner and Oscar Berliner
Synopsis
Director Alan Berliner takes on his reclusive father as the reluctant subject of this affecting and graceful study of family history and memory. Ultimately this complex portrait is a meeting of the minds -- where the past meets the present, where generations collide and where the boundaries of family life are stretched, torn and surprisingly, at times, also healed. Berliner has transformed a story of a troubled man who has sealed himself off from life's pain into a work of universal resonance.
